How to reduce arthritis pain
If you’re feeling stiffness in the joints, have swelling or pain around the joints is an indication of arthritis. It may be due to overweight, illness, injury or even hereditary. To reduce pain and swelling, doctors may prescribe pain killers or creams. Massages, relaxation therapy, reduction in weight and nutritional supplements may be suggested. If it’s severe you have to consult a specialist to undergo regular treatment. Managing pain is a key relief procedure for you.
